2021-01-31

ELC

Playful otters, a sculpture in a garden of butterflies at the Environmental Learning Center ELC) in Vero Beach, Florida.

This is Smokey stay tuned for the next episode of Deaf Anthology, Good Night Deaf America.

No comments:

Post a Comment